Hongjin Li
e4bf00a5e8
fix: 添加LOSCFG_MAX_OPEN_DIRS标识最大可打开dir数量
...
提供LOSCFG_MAX_OPEN_DIRS宏定义,标识最大可打开dir数量。新增g_dirNum静态变量,标识已打开的dir数量。
在opendir成功时g_dirNum++,在closedir成功时g_dirNum--。
BREAKING CHANGE:
新增LOSCFG_MAX_OPEN_DIRS宏定义,标识最大可打开dir数量。
Close #I6416D
Signed-off-by: Hongjin Li <lihongjin1@huawei.com>
2022-12-01 09:55:28 +08:00
openharmony_ci
43c6a8056b
!943 【OpenHarmony-3.2-Beta3】文件系统提供动态内存分配器钩子
...
Merge pull request !943 from Far/OpenHarmony-3.2-Beta3
2022-11-29 04:01:43 +00:00
Far
bbb1c73322
feat: 文件系统提供动态内存分配器钩子
...
增加LOS_FS_MALLOC/LOS_FS_FREE宏以提供用户配置动态内存分配器的能力。
用户只需要在components/fs/vfs/los_fs.h中修改对应的函数即可。
BREAKING CHANGE:
文件系统提供动态内存分配器钩子
新增宏:
LOS_FS_MALLOC
LOS_FS_FREE
fix #I63J0C
Signed-off-by: Far <yesiyuan2@huawei.com>
Change-Id: I00e642cb83e7a10dcae6166b307755c428390945
2022-11-28 20:03:25 +08:00
openharmony_ci
cbf91caf0d
!932 Fix : 内核告警清理
...
Merge pull request !932 from yinjiaming/cherry-pick-1669173260
2022-11-23 06:04:25 +00:00
yinjiaming
64da4a5fbc
fixed a4087a6 from https://gitee.com/hgbveiu743/kernel_liteos_m/pulls/930
...
Fix: 内核告警清理
消除了多余的空格
Signed-off-by: yinjiaming <yinjiaming@huawei.com>
Change-Id: Ibe90fcf8c46ef9a60c0a8f4dbba07d399e139b8c
2022-11-23 03:14:20 +00:00
openharmony_ci
49950a52d1
!925 告警清理
...
Merge pull request !925 from 乔克叔叔/liuwenxin
2022-11-23 02:03:11 +00:00
openharmony_ci
77b1f175fc
!927 告警清理
...
Merge pull request !927 from 乔克叔叔/liuwx
2022-11-23 01:45:47 +00:00
liuwenxin
d14a45a1c5
Fix:m核告警清理
...
Signed-off-by: liuwenxin <liuwenxin11@huawei.com>
2022-11-21 16:28:58 +08:00
liuwenxin
860fa611ee
fix:告警清理
...
Signed-off-by: liuwenxin <liuwenxin11@huawei.com>
2022-11-21 11:03:33 +08:00
openharmony_ci
b59f3d871d
!922 挑单 其他分区已mount时会引起格式化失败至3.2-beta3
...
Merge pull request !922 from wangchen/1119_0930_m
2022-11-18 09:57:02 +00:00
wangchen
d264a032fc
fix: 挑单 其他分区已mount时会引起格式化失败至3.2-beta3
...
【背景】其他分区已mount时会引起格式化失败至3.2-beta3
【修改方案】
1, 格式化时判断方式修改为路径
【影响】
对现有的产品编译不会有影响。
re #I61VSO
Signed-off-by: wangchen <wangchen240@huawei.com>
2022-11-18 06:52:09 +00:00
openharmony_ci
110b201e69
!915 【OpenHarmony-3.2-Beta3】修复mount接口对MS_REMOUNT的支持
...
Merge pull request !915 from Far/cherry-pick-1668503524
2022-11-16 03:06:09 +00:00
Far
d5bc445a4e
fixed 64d15df from https://gitee.com/yesiyuanjim/kernel_liteos_m/pulls/909
...
fix: fix the MS_REMOUNT support
The mount interface can't deal with MS_REMOUNT flag now, fix it.
Signed-off-by: Far <yesiyuan2@huawei.com>
Change-Id: Id0960c8d92ce767b8d8ef98b3ba2e1d1ab7db15d
2022-11-15 09:12:04 +00:00
openharmony_ci
00f7b6ac63
!889 【 同步到OpenHarmony-3.2-Beta3分支】feat:支持mutex trace
...
Merge pull request !889 from zhangdengyu/OpenHarmony-3.2-Beta3
2022-11-08 02:59:22 +00:00
openharmony_ci
2f6ae64adc
!887 cortex-m4支持iar编译器的gn适配
...
Merge pull request !887 from yiweiniunan/cherry-pick-1667812611
2022-11-07 11:13:33 +00:00
zhangdengyu
07f7213885
同步:新增mutex trace.
...
Close:#I5ZMNK
Signed-off-by: zhangdengyu <zhangdengyu2@huawei.com>
2022-11-07 17:39:19 +08:00
yiweiniunan
c83efabbeb
fixed 62cd8fe from https://gitee.com/yiweiniunan/kernel_liteos_m/pulls/886
...
cortex-m4支持iar编译器的gn适配
Signed-off-by: yiweiniunan <michael.likai@huawei.com>
2022-11-07 09:16:51 +00:00
openharmony_ci
02aaa768dc
!882 【回合3.2Beta3】feat: 提供死机场景下dump文件能力
...
Merge pull request !882 from Zhaotianyu/cherry-pick-1667647145
2022-11-07 01:34:49 +00:00
arvinzzz
b8f8715040
fixed 4742015 from https://gitee.com/arvinzzz/kernel_liteos_m/pulls/881
...
feat: 提供死机场景下dump文件的能力
死机场景下,vfs层锁会放开,提供dump文件的能力
Signed-off-by: arvinzzz <zhaotianyu9@huawei.com>
Change-Id: Id8c9e63fbf011dbc6690b9b4557bd3370353bf21
2022-11-05 11:19:05 +00:00
openharmony_ci
a967903ae8
!875 挑单-pm idle控制选项添加到menuconfig中至OpenHarmony-3.2-Beta3
...
Merge pull request !875 from zhushengle/cherry-pick-1667528857
2022-11-04 05:58:44 +00:00
zhushengle
af8c69507e
fixed 98d20e9 from https://gitee.com/zhushengle/kernel_liteos_m/pulls/874
...
feat: pm idle添加到menuconfig中
Close #I5ZD5L
Signed-off-by: zhushengle <zhushengle@huawei.com>
Change-Id: Ibdedff3043a0902aa3cd9539497ef97fb6a1ce6c
2022-11-04 02:27:38 +00:00
openharmony_ci
c9c8d68f5f
!848 挑单 fs相关修改同步3.2-beta3
...
Merge pull request !848 from wangchen/1010_m
2022-10-11 02:31:37 +00:00
wangchen
3dec8a92df
fix: 挑单 fs相关修改同步3.2-beta3
...
【背景】挑单 fs相关修改同步3.2-beta3
【修改方案】
1, 同步mount相关检视修改
2, 同步mount不可重入问题
3, 同步fcntl编译问题
【影响】
对现有的产品编译不会有影响。
re #I5UX7W
Signed-off-by: wangchen <wangchen240@huawei.com>
2022-10-10 09:11:15 +00:00
openharmony_ci
06631fce7d
!839 fix: 修复内核低功耗模式调整后同步问题
...
Merge pull request !839 from zhushengle/cherry-pick-1664191999
2022-09-28 07:22:34 +00:00
zhushengle
6d3a950a21
fixed 5bae8b5 from https://gitee.com/zhushengle/kernel_liteos_m/pulls/831
...
fix: 修复内核低功耗模式调整后同步问题
Close #I5SNYA
Signed-off-by: zhushengle <zhushengle@huawei.com>
Change-Id: I4df212bbf3e522ea371b5340848ba5adf2668ad7
2022-09-26 11:33:23 +00:00
openharmony_ci
798fbd0212
!837 同步清除内核告警信息
...
Merge pull request !837 from 夏不白/cherry-pick-1664026693
2022-09-25 08:30:56 +00:00
xiacong
784429d0dc
<fix>
...
修复报警信息,为以下修复点
1、修复空指针未判断
2、修复open后未及时close 导致内存泄露
3、修复strdup后未free
4、修复赋值后未使用等问题
5、修复编码中判断条件中无符号变量小于零的情况
Signed-off-by: xiacong <xiacong4@huawei.com>
Change-Id: I13d046141afeb8a116e6a04304a3793bf8e12bee
Signed-off-by: xiacong <xiacong4@huawei.com>
2022-09-24 22:11:27 +08:00
openharmony_ci
044cf59583
!825 M核用例编译问题修复, 内核补充fcntl
...
Merge pull request !825 from wangchen/0917_m
2022-09-22 09:06:20 +00:00
openharmony_ci
1a66fa3daf
!829 Fix : 内核告警清理挑单
...
Merge pull request !829 from yinjiaming/cherry-pick-1663655884
2022-09-22 06:11:42 +00:00
wangchen
0adbafb9c2
\fix: M核用例编译问题修复
...
【背景】M核用例编译问题修复
【修改方案】
1, 添加musl缺失的fcntl
2,删除musl下对fcntl和ioctl的依赖
3,修改fs和vfs种fcntl入参的处理
【影响】
对现有的产品编译不会有影响。
re #I5PKBJ
Signed-off-by: wangchen <wangchen240@huawei.com>
2022-09-21 07:20:12 +00:00
openharmony_ci
3398937b1b
!822 Fix : 内核告警清理
...
Merge pull request !822 from yinjiaming/fix
2022-09-21 04:42:39 +00:00
openharmony_ci
3c010b4717
!828 【轻量级 PR】:【OpenHarmony开源贡献者计划2022】fix warning: 'return' with a value, in function returning void
...
Merge pull request !828 from wangziyi0929/N/A
2022-09-21 03:09:31 +00:00
yinjiaming
c237ff63fa
fix: 内核告警修复
...
【背景】
内核代码经扫描工具检测发现有可以修改的
告警
【修改方案】
1. 对只有单一语句的if, while等添加括号使之符合编程规范
2. 将C 风格的类型转换变为 C++ 风格的
【影响】
对现有的产品编译不会有影响。
Signed-off-by: yinjiaming <yinjiaming@huawei.com>
Change-Id: I0b7659882eec777cade3ee21e76a42a86e2ce822
2022-09-21 10:30:30 +08:00
wangziyi0929
3508110f6d
fix warning: 'return' with a value, in function returning void
...
Signed-off-by: wangziyi0929 <915619048@qq.com>
2022-09-19 07:55:05 +00:00
openharmony_ci
ffa868a81c
!827 M核对公共基础类库路径依赖修改
...
Merge pull request !827 from wangchen/0919_m
2022-09-19 07:06:17 +00:00
wangchen
7d391c9bbf
fix: M核对公共基础类库路径依赖修改
...
【背景】M核对公共基础类库路径依赖修改
【修改方案】
1, 修改lwip依赖的路径
【影响】
对现有的产品编译不会有影响。
re #I5RSMC
Signed-off-by: wangchen <wangchen240@huawei.com>
https://gitee.com/openharmony/kernel_liteos_m/issues/I5RSMC
2022-09-19 06:28:16 +00:00
openharmony_ci
e4a1c18d40
!826 【OpenHarmony开源贡献者计划2022】 删除未初始化的变量ret
...
Merge pull request !826 from 刘淦/master
2022-09-19 02:38:00 +00:00
liugan
83790f4f9b
remove unused variable ret
...
Signed-off-by: liugan <liugan_public@163.com>
2022-09-17 17:16:17 +08:00
openharmony_ci
b8f8ab5a36
!807 非安全函数告警清理
...
Merge pull request !807 from xuxinyu/function_s
2022-08-26 04:45:26 +00:00
xuxinyu
a0b776a709
非安全函数告警清理
...
Signed-off-by: xuxinyu <xuxinyu6@huawei.com>
Change-Id: I45bbaa3568be3679b34b1e8b072d19d878fdbf02
2022-08-25 20:50:48 +08:00
openharmony_ci
f5f18ca669
!812 fix:iccarm下fs的编译错误
...
Merge pull request !812 from Zhaotianyu/20220824iccarm_fs_fix
2022-08-24 10:49:19 +00:00
arvinzzz
5756d45e84
fix: 修复fs在iccarm下的编译错误
...
close: #I5NXFL
Signed-off-by: arvinzzz <zhaotianyu9@huawei.com>
2022-08-24 16:59:42 +08:00
openharmony_ci
8a25f31aa4
!809 unittest关联issue
...
Merge pull request !809 from Hongjin Li/dev2
2022-08-24 06:36:20 +00:00
Hongjin Li
f7cc6ff14e
test: unittest 关联 issue number
...
Signed-off-by: Hongjin Li <lihongjin1@huawei.com>
Change-Id: I0a735c85c004ef3171eb170effacc034e3c8cd1a
2022-08-24 11:31:55 +08:00
openharmony_ci
bf9e0c9e2b
!805 补充unittest用例描述
...
Merge pull request !805 from Hongjin Li/dev1
2022-08-23 14:03:19 +00:00
Hongjin Li
e9de74a94a
test: testcase description
...
Signed-off-by: Hongjin Li <lihongjin1@huawei.com>
Change-Id: I1f8067dfbde2c12c092d5c9570f6ad45430f58ef
Change-Id: Ifad39593d943a29771691b6c23289d9774f5dfab
2022-08-23 21:20:54 +08:00
openharmony_ci
b38f135242
!795 低功耗增加idle选项
...
Merge pull request !795 from zhushengle/pm
2022-08-23 13:06:03 +00:00
openharmony_ci
0cb50baa55
!801 编译构建规范优化
...
Merge pull request !801 from Hongjin Li/dev
2022-08-23 12:26:15 +00:00
Hongjin Li
565049f1eb
style: string format in python
...
Signed-off-by: Hongjin Li <lihongjin1@huawei.com>
Change-Id: I0d6ffb978bf4f96fd546868a6dd5f20d2cefbfd6
2022-08-23 18:52:42 +08:00
zhushengle
9add4b4b92
feat: 低功耗增加idle选项
...
Close #I5N9J2
Signed-off-by: zhushengle <zhushengle@huawei.com>
Change-Id: I066ff415709145e585f1eb94e70263361d3d71af
2022-08-22 17:04:08 +08:00